Автотестирование

Автотестирование
Автоматизируем тестирование ваших сервисов и приложений: поможем ускорить разработку и создать более производительное и безопасное решение

С чем мы работаем

Десктопные приложения

Десктопные приложения

Десктоп-приложения, legacy- и консольные приложения независимо от технологии: WPF, CEF, Java, Python.
Web-приложения& DevOps

Web-приложения

Функциональное тестирование динамических веб-интерфейсов на любом MVC фреймворке на нескольких браузерах.
Сервисы

Сервисы

Нагрузочное и функциональное тестирование Web API и сервисов, тестирование производительности.
iPhone приложения

iPhone приложения

Нативный XCUITest или AppiumDriver в связке с XCUIDriver для функционального тестирования.
Android приложения

Android приложения

Espresso, Instrumental Test для нативных тестов, или AppiumDriver + UIAutomator для функциональных.

Нужна ли автоматизация на вашем проекте?

Автотестирование требуется не каждому проекту. Понять, какие выгоды принесет автоматизация, поможет разработка ROI-метрик.

Наши специалисты проведут анализ, который покажет, готов ли ваш проект к автоматизации, сколько это будет стоить и как снизит затраты в итоге.



ROI-анализ перед началом проекта покажет:

  • Ожидаемую стоимость автоматизации тестирования.
  • Ожидания по срокам проекта.
  • Оптимальную методику тестирования: ручное или АТ.
  • Ожидаемую эффективность и результат автотестирования.
python
Java
Kotlin
C++
Swift
Robot
Play
Cucumber
S
Allure
Visual Studio
Apache JMeter

Какие бизнес-задачи могут решить специалисты WaveAccess:

Закажите инспекцию кода

Наши инженеры используют фреймворки, библиотеки и инструменты тестирования на различных платформах, что обеспечит качественное покрытие тестами и оптимальную цену сервиса.

Ревью кода (code review) выявляет проблемы с безопасностью приложения и корректным использованием технологий.

Тестирование производительности покажет скорость работы, стабильность приложения по различным параметрам.

Стресс-тесты помогут увидеть, соответствует ли продукт заявленным метрикам масштабируемости.

Мы поможем выбрать методику тестирования.

Что мы предлагаем:

  • Функциональное тестирование.
  • Тестирование UI (мобильное, веб, десктоп).
  • Black\White box тестирование.
  • Сквозное тестирование.
  • Инструментальные тесты.
  • Нагрузочное тестирование.
  • Интеграционное тестирование.
  • Юнит тестирование.
  • Стресс-тесты, тестирование масштабируемости.
  • Конфигурационное тестирование.
  • Тестирование безопасности.

Что дает автоматизация тестирования

Конкурентоспособный продукт

Конкурентоспособный продукт

Тесты помогают выявить угрозы, сделать продукт производительнее, не увеличивая стоимость.
Ускорение релизов

Ускорение релизов

Разработка тестов по принципу пирамиды помогает получить преимущество в скорости доставки продукта.
Меньше рутинных операций

Меньше рутинных операций

Автоматизация (в том числе, регресс-тесты) высвобождает время специалистов для более важных задач.

Анализ результатов и наглядные отчеты

Мы создадим тест-план и тест-кейсы, которые покроют запланированную функциональность приложения и позволят спрогнозировать соответствие вашего продукта ожидаемому качеству.

Автоматизация приносит результат вне зависимости от размеров проекта: важно грамотно применить ее к бизнес-логике и подобрать подходящие алгоритмы.
Функциональное тестирование полного цикла
Покрытие автоматическими тестами регресс-набора увеличит скорость выпуска релиза. Мы также протестируем функции ПО на модульном уровне (компонентов) и на интеграционном уровне (связей между компонентами).
Автоматизация регресс-тестирования

Этапы работы

Запрос Заказчика
QA- и SDET-Анализ
Выбор платформ
Демо-версия АТ
Continuous Integration
Пилотная версия АТ
Пошаговое внедрение
Поддержка и Helpdesk фреймворка
Поддержка и консалтинг команды Заказчика

Клиенты

На протяжении 2 лет мы сотрудничали с WaveAccess на проектах, связанных с разработкой программного обеспечения и научно-исследовательских приложений. Мы очень впечатлены тем, как быстро специалисты WaveAccess понимают требования ученых и реализуют их в программном обеспечении в лучшем возможном варианте. Поиск и устранение неисправностей никогда не были проблемой — коллеги из WaveAccess быстро реагируют на любые отклонения, которые неизбежны в процессе создания программного обеспечения. Команда WaveAccess высокопрофессиональна и надежна, особенно в проектах с участием нескольких компаний. У них есть и собственные высококвалифицированные разработчики программного обеспечения, и проверенные внештатные подрядчики, если для проекта необходима уникальная экспертиза, не представленная в основной команде. Набор навыков основной команды охватывает все популярные языки программирования и программные платформы. Я рекомендую WaveAccess для любого вашего проекта по разработке программного обеспечения.
 waveaccess client thomson reuters
Мы работаем с WaveAccess уже более 10 лет на различных проектах, и они всегда выполняют свою работу в срок и в рамках оговоренного бюджета. Мы вместе занимались веб проектами, интеграциями, загрузкой данных, построением de novo платформ, поддержкой и дальнейшей разработкой унаследованного кода, документацией и мобильными приложениями, и каждый раз мы оставались очень довольны работой WaveAccess.

Ключевые Факты

400Сотрудников
  • Разработчики
  • Дизайнеры
  • Верстальщики
  • DevOps-специалисты
  • Руководители проектов
  • QA-инженеры
  • Аналитики
  • Маркетологи
300проектов
  • Web
  • Mobile
  • Desktop
  • Database
  • Cloud
  • QA
19лет опыта успешной разработки IT-решений

Начните новый проект с нами!

Запросите смету или назначьте
консультацию с нашим техническим экспертом

Alex Ostapovich
Blockchain Consultant
Или оставьте свои контактные данные, и мы свяжемся с вами в течение одного рабочего дня

Похожие сервисы

Проверка качества
Разработка приложений
DevOps-подход для достижения бизнес-результата